Testing with a PLC tag table
You can monitor the current data values of tags in the CPU directly in the PLC tag table. To do
so, open the PLC tag table and start the monitoring.
You may also copy PLC tags to a watch table or force table and monitor, modify or force them
there.
Testing with a data block editor
The data block editor offers different options for monitoring and modifying tags. These
functions directly access the actual values of the tags in the online program. Actual values are
the current values of tags in the CPU work memory at any given moment during program
execution. The following functions for monitoring and modifying are available in the
database editor.
• Monitor tags online
• Modify individual actual values
• Create a snapshot of the actual values
